This is an adapatation by U. Frisch of an English translation by Thomas E. Burton of Euler's memoir `Principes g\'en\'eraux du mouvement des fluides' (Euler, 1775b). Burton's translation appeared in Fluid Dynamics, 34} (1999) pp. 801-82, Springer and is here adapted by permission. A detailed presentation of Euler's published work can be found in Truesdell, 1954. Euler's work is discussed also in the perspective of eighteenth century fluid dynamics research by Darrigol and Frisch, 2008. Explanatory footnotes have been supplied where necessary by G.K. Mikhailov and a few more by U. Frisch and O.Darrigol. Euler's memoir had neither footnotes nor a list of references.
